Whether you’re planning a major renovation or looking for simple tweaks, there are many ways to enhance the natural light in your home. Understanding the benefits of natural light is the first step. Increased exposure to daylight can improve mood and productivity, and even reduce energy costs. Homes with ample natural light often feel more spacious and open, making them more appealing to both residents and visitors. Natural light creates a warm, welcoming environment, making it an integral feature in modern home design.One of the most effective strategies for increasing natural light is through thoughtful window placement and sizing. Larger windows or floor-to-ceiling designs allow more light to flood into the room. Consider installing windows that face south or west to maximize sun exposure throughout the day. Skylights are another fantastic option, particularly in rooms where traditional windows may not be feasible. These overhead installations can deliver consistent daylight and are perfect for areas like hallways or bathrooms.Updating your choice of window treatments can also make a significant difference. Opt for sheer curtains or light-colored blinds that allow light penetration without sacrificing privacy. Avoid blocking windows with heavy, dark drapery that can obstruct sunlight. Instead, select materials that complement the room’s decor while enhancing its brightness.Another remodeling consideration is the use of reflective materials within your interior design. Paint walls with light, neutral colors that reflect rather than absorb light. Incorporate mirrors strategically within a room to bounce light around, making spaces feel larger and brighter. Shiny tiles or glass elements can add to this reflective effect, enhancing the distribution of natural light within the space.Remodeling spaces such as walls plays a crucial role in optimizing light flow. Taking down non-structural walls can open up living areas, allowing light to travel unhindered across rooms. Open floor plans are increasingly popular for their ability to create airy, interconnected spaces. If removing walls isn’t an option, consider sleek, internal glass partitions that maintain flow while providing the division you need without blocking light.Doors can also be an essential part of your transformation. French doors, particularly ones fitted with glass panels, can unify indoor and outdoor spaces while letting in much more light. These doors can be used within the house as well to separate rooms without cutting off light access.
